WebApr 15, 2024 · The term malnutrition covers 2 broad groups of conditions. One is ‘undernutrition’—which includes stunting (low height for age), wasting (low weight for height), underweight (low weight for age) and micronutrient deficiencies or insufficiencies (a lack of important vitamins and minerals). WebHormone Complications From Being Underweight. Underweight girls, in particular, can experience hormone disregulation. They may menstruate irregularly, or not menstruate at all. Being underweight is a form of stress that causes your body to alter hormone production, so it can focus on other essential body functions that keep you alive.

Anorexia nervosa is a serious and potentially life-threatening — but treatable — eating disorder. It's characterized by extreme food restriction and an intense fear of gaining weight. Treatment usually involves several strategies, including psychological therapy, nutritional counseling and/or hospitalization.
